Kirby was a loving father, grandfather and great grandfather. He was a devoted husband to his wife, Katherine, until her passing in August 2012. Kirby worked hard at local 692 as a pipe line construction worker to provide for his family until his well-deserved retirement. After he retired, he owned and operated his auto body repair shop, Triple K. Before Kirbys passing he stated "no one grieve for me because you are looking at a happy man for I am where I longed to be, with my dear wife and my Savior. I have grieved for this since the Lord took her home". Kirby always kept his trust and faith in the Lord and as time went on he learned to lean and depend on Him much more. He was blessed twice in the month of November-the first time was when he was born and the second time was his spiritual birthday on November 15, 1973.  At that time, he devoted his life to God and telling others his testimony. Kirby will be greatly missed by all who knew and loved him.
